Naoto Shikama is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Naoto Shikama has authored 146 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 57 papers in Surgery, 45 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 43 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Naoto Shikama’s work include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(39 papers), Head and Neck Cancer Studies (29 papers) and Management of metastatic bone disease (23 papers). Naoto Shikama is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(39 papers), Head and Neck Cancer Studies (29 papers) and Management of metastatic bone disease (23 papers). Naoto Shikama coll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and China. Naoto Shikama's co-authors include Masahiko Oguchi, Takashi Uno, Jun Itami, Takafumi Toita, Katsumasa Nakamura, Hisao Ito, Kazuhiko Ogawa, Koichi Isobe, Takeshi Kodaira and Hiroshi Ohnishi and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, The EMBO Journal and Cancer.
